Compass(TM)885 USB modem and AirCard(R) 885E ExpressCard deliver HSPA
mobile broadband access and user-friendly features in more compact designs
Mobile World Congress, BARCELONA, Spain, Feb. 11 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/
- Sierra Wireless (NASDAQ: SWIR - TSX: SW) has added two new products to
its lineup of HSPA mobile broadband modems. The AirCard(R) 885E ExpressCard
and the Compass(TM) 885 USB modem are small, full-featured, and offer the
latest high-speed mobile broadband technology for use worldwide. Both
products are on display for the first time this week in the Sierra Wireless
pavilion (AV99) at Mobile World Congress in Barcelona, Spain.
The Sierra Wireless Compass(TM) 885 tri-band USB modem for HSPA
networks packs more features in a smaller volume than any current
counterpart. Designed to offer a flawless user experience, the Compass 885
USB modem includes TRU-Install(TM) software installation to simplify setup,
a microSD memory card slot to expand its functionality, and a laptop clip
accessory to provide flexibility in use. Compatible with mobile broadband
networks worldwide, the Compass 885 USB modem is the only product in its
class to include a connector for an external antenna, allowing users in
remote areas or fringe network coverage to extend and strengthen their
connection to the network.
With a more compact ExpressCard design, the AirCard 885E is an ideal
wireless modem for people who regularly travel with a notebook computer
that includes an ExpressCard slot. Its durable, fixed antenna design with
no moving parts offers a reliable wireless connection, and with TRU-Install
software installation, customers are up and running quickly with no need
for an installation CD.

The Compass 885 USB modem and the AirCard 885E ExpressCard support
tri-band HSPA/UMTS with receive diversity on all three bands, and quad-band
EDGE/GPRS/GSM, making them ideal for world travelers. Both products offer
peak data speeds of up to 7.2 megabits per second on the downlink, and up
to 2.0 Mbps on the uplink (software upgradeable to 5.76 Mbps uplink as
future improvements become available). They are compatible with both
Windows and Mac notebooks and desktops and offer GPS support for location
based services such as local search and navigation applications. Both the
AirCard 885E ExpressCard and the Compass 885 USB modem are scheduled for
commercial availability in mid-2008.
